Anybody have a suggestion? I'm getting a slight rapping noise in the front of the engine. Could this be just a timing thing? Valves? I yoinked out both the CCT's and they are in fine working order.

Scott said
I yoinked out both the CCT's and they are in fine working order.
Does this mean you have stuck the same one's back in or you have replaced them?
My front was rattling/slapping only as the engine warmed up. Not when cold and not when hot. After putting the little locking key into the mechanism and removing the tensioner I had a play with it and could find nothing wrong. There was loads of adustment left.
I changed the bugger anyway because I had aready bought one and now the noise has gone.
I guess the other one was backing off as it warmed up so I,ve binned it as I could never trust it now
